North Country Heliflite, located at 10915 NY-149 in Fort Ann, New York, operates as a highly specialized tour operator, focusing exclusively on providing aerial experiences via helicopter. Unlike a traditional travel agency that might book a variety of accommodations and transport, this company's core offering is a unique perspective on the region's landscapes, primarily centered around Lake George and the surrounding Adirondack and Green Mountains. The business has garnered a significant amount of positive feedback, holding a high rating based on numerous customer reviews. The consensus points towards a premium, professionally managed service that consistently delivers memorable flights.

Service Offerings and Fleet

The primary service is scenic helicopter tours. Research on their official offerings shows structured packages, including a 30-minute tour focused on Lake George and a more extensive 60-minute "Works" tour that covers a broader territory. The company also explicitly offers custom tours, allowing clients to design a flight path based on personal points of interest, a key feature for those looking for a unique form of adventure travel. The aircraft typically used is a Robinson R44 Raven II helicopter, which has a capacity for three passengers. This small group size ensures an intimate and personal experience, where every passenger has a window seat and a direct line of communication with the pilot. Beyond tourism, North Country Heliflite also engages in commercial aviation services like aerial photography and surveys, a fact that underscores their professional capabilities and expertise in the field.

Potential Drawbacks and Considerations

While the feedback is almost universally positive, any potential customer should consider a few practical realities before booking. These are not necessarily negatives but important factors for planning and managing expectations.

  • Significant Cost: Helicopter tours are an inherently expensive activity. While one reviewer noted the pricing was "fair" for the experience, the absolute cost is substantial. Research suggests a one-hour flight can cost several hundred dollars for the charter. This positions the service as a premium, special-occasion activity rather than a casual outing. It is a significant investment and may not fit into all travelers' vacation packages or budgets.
  • Weather Dependency: As with all aviation, operations are entirely dependent on favorable weather conditions. Flights can be, and often are, cancelled or rescheduled due to wind, rain, or low visibility. This can be a major inconvenience for travelers on a tight schedule or those who have planned their trip around the flight. Flexibility is a must.
  • Limited Capacity: The three-passenger maximum of the Robinson R44 helicopter means that families or groups larger than three will need to book separate, consecutive flights. This could be a logistical challenge and might detract from the shared experience for larger parties.
  • Booking and Availability: Given that the operation appears to revolve around a single primary pilot, availability can be limited, especially during peak tourist seasons. Spontaneous bookings are likely difficult to secure, and advanced planning is highly recommended.
  • Lack of Online Price Transparency: The company's website does not list specific prices for its tours, requiring potential customers to call or email for a quote. In an age where travelers are accustomed to seeing all costs upfront, this extra step can be a minor hurdle in the planning process.
